Position Summary
The Coordinator, Community Giving plays a key supporting role within the Community Giving team at Sunnybrook Foundation. This position is responsible for coordinating and executing administrative and operational functions that enable the effective implementation of fundraising campaigns and donor engagement initiatives, with a focus on direct response, mid-level, monthly, and tribute giving, as well as the staff and community 50/50 lottery.
Reporting to the Executive Director, Community Giving this role works cross-functionally with colleagues across the Foundation, including Marketing & Communications, Finance, and Donor Relations. The Coordinator brings str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a passion for donor experience and philanthropy to help deliver exceptional results that support Sunnybrook’s mission to invent the future of health care.
Key Duties and Responsibilities
Campaign and Program Coordination
- Assist in coordinating the staff and community 50/50 lottery programs, including ticket sales tracking, prize logistics, reporting, and AGCO compliance documentation.
- Help maintain campaign calendars and monitor campaign milestones and deadlines to ensure smooth execution.
- Support the planning and execution of integrated fundraising campaigns (e.g., direct mail, email, phone, digital, D2D) by managing timelines, tracking deliverables, and coordinating with internal and external partners.
Data, Reporting & Donor Engagement
- Support stewardship activities for direct response and mid-level donors, including sending thank-you notes, coordinating donor recognition packages, and assisting with personal outreach initiatives.
- Generate regular and ad hoc reports related to campaign performance, donor engagement, and revenue tracking as required.
Administrative Support
- Manage the coordination of Community Giving invoices, ensuring timely approval by the signing authority and processing by the finance department.
- Manage shared team resources, including campaign files, meeting agendas and summaries of next steps and action items, and budget tracking documents.
- Prepare presentations, briefing notes, and internal reports to support planning and decision-making.
- Monitor inventory and coordinate the production of campaign collateral, stewardship materials, and promotional items.
Team Collaboration & Cross-Functional Support
- Provide project support for key departmental initiatives, including strategic planning sessions, program reviews, and cross-functional collaborations.
- Support the integration of Community Giving strategies across departments by assisting with internal coordination and communication.
- Participate in regular team meetings, brainstorming sessions, and training opportunities to contribute ideas and promote continuous improvement.
Qualifications and Competencies
- Minimum 2 years of experience in a fundraising, marketing, or administrative support role (ideally within the nonprofit or healthcare sector).
- Highly organized, detail-oriented, and able to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
- Excellent interpersonal and communication skills, with a professional and donor-centered approach.
- Proficient in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int); experience with donor databases (e.g., Raiser’s Edge, CRM Solutions) is an asset.
- Comfortable working with data, tracking campaign performance, and producing reports.
- Demonstrated ability to work collaboratively as part of a team and independently.

Total Rewards Package
The hiring range for this position is $47,000 - 58,000. The salary will be determined based on the successful candidate’s years of experience, qualifications and competencies that are relevant to this position.
In addition to salary, our competitive compensation package also includes, comprehensive health and dental benefits, HOOPP (Healthcare of Ontario Pension Plan), hybrid work environment with a minimum of two (2) days in office, 2 float days each fiscal year and additional Sunny Days (long weekend closures in advance of summer long weekends and Christmas Eve).
